Except for those folks living under rocks (sounds uncomfortable), everyone knows about or at least has heard of bitcoin. However, not everyone understands the technology of bitcoin, which extends well beyond Internet-based currency.
For the rock people, bitcoin is an Internet-based currency that allows for transparency with respect to each transfer of the currency through the use of a distributed database. Each transaction is locked in a block, and blocks are connected to form a “blockchain.”
What Is Blockchain?
Blockchain is an open source technology that facilitates creating each block, locking each block, and connecting the resulting
string of blocks. Because it is a write-only database that never can be edited or deleted, the blockchain gives integrity to the
complete history of the transaction.
